Overview
- ESPN’s Buster Olney says it appears inevitable the Mets will sign either Framber Valdez or Ranger Suárez, noting Suárez as a particularly strong fit.
- Bleacher Report’s Joel Reuter predicts New York will add Valdez to front the rotation, characterizing it as a forecast rather than a done deal.
- The Mets have yet to add a starter to their 40-man roster after a 2025 season that used 17 starting pitchers and produced an 18th-ranked rotation ERA.
- Reports describe Valdez as a durable, ground-ball–driven lefty with multiple 190-inning seasons, two All-Star nods, and a World Series title.
- Suárez enters free agency off a 3.20 ERA and 4.7 bWAR in 2025 with an All-Star nod in 2024 and a standout 1.48 career postseason ERA.
